Project Description

The project brief called for reimagining the home’s spacious lower level as a warm and inviting sanctuary with separate areas for work and relaxation. Tasked with balancing two primary if somewhat opposite programs, we embraced a mid-century ethos to create an aesthetically consonant sequence of spaces that elevate both work and play.

Long and rectangular, with 11-foot ceilings and two doors that lead directly outside, the basement was a generous tabula rasa. To accommodate the program requirements and imbue the space with personality, we carved out two separate areas that nevertheless communicate with one another through sliding glass pocket doors and material continuity.
